Data Science and Applied Statistics, M.S.


Admission Requirements

Applicants to the M.S. in data science and applied statistics degree program (also known as “MDSAS”) must hold a bachelor’s degree, must have taken a course in statistics and must have taken mathematics courses through multivariate calculus. The GRE graduate school admission test is optional. Applicants must have excellent English communication skills. If required, TOEFL English language proficiency test scores should be in accordance with the requirements specified by the Moody School of Graduate and Advanced Studies. Degree Requirements


To qualify for the M.S. in data science and applied statistics, the student must successfully complete at least 36 credit hours acceptable to the departmental faculty, distributed as follows:
